茶树菇水煎液对环磷酰胺诱发小鼠基因突变的保护作用
Protection effect of decoction from Agrocybe aegerita on mice mutation induced by cyclophosphamide
【摘要】 目的研究茶树菇水煎液对环磷酰胺诱发KM小鼠突变的保护作用。方法用改进的小鼠骨髓细胞微核实验和小鼠精子畸形实验方法,研究茶树菇水煎液对环磷酰胺诱发小鼠骨髓细胞微核和精子畸形的保护作用。结果给40 mg/kg环磷酰胺后,茶树菇水煎液低、中、高剂量组及阳性对照组的微核率、精子畸形率均比阴性对照组显著升高(P<0.01),茶树菇水煎液高剂量组的微核率18.2‰,显著低于阳性对照组微核率25.8‰(P<0.01),茶树菇水煎液高剂量组的精子畸形率58.7‰,显著低于阳性对照组精子畸形率76.5‰(P<0.01)。结论茶树菇水煎液对环磷酰胺诱发小鼠骨髓细胞微核和精子畸形有保护作用。
【Abstract】 [Objective]To study protection effect of decoction from Agrocybe aegerita on KM mice mutation induced by cyclophosphamide(CP).[Methods]The protection effect of decoction from Agrocybe aegerita on mice bone marrow cell micronucleu and sperm aberration induced by CP was studied according to changed tests of mice micronucleu and sperm aberration.[Results] After Given 40 mg/kg CP,micronucleu rate and sperm aberration rate of low,middle,high doses of decoction from Agrocybe aegerita and the positive control were significantly higher than that of the negative control(P<0.01)Micronucleu rate of high dose of decoction from Agrocybe aegerita was 18.2‰ which was significantly lower than the positive control(25.8‰)(P<0.01).Sperm aberration rate of high dose of decoction from Agrocybe aegerita was 58.7‰ which was significantly lower than the positive control(76.5‰)(P<0.01).[Conclusion]Decoction from Agrocybe aegerita has protection effect on KM mice marrow cell micronucleu and KM sperm aberration induced by CP.
